FORMER McKINNEY POSTMASTER DIES
McKinney – Funeral services will be held at 3 p.m. Tuesday in the First Christian Church here for Don O. Davis, 73, father of Collin County Judge Don Weaver Davis. Mr. Davis died at 11 p.m. Sunday in a McKinney hospital. He was a life-long resident of Collin county.
Dr. E. E. Russell, pastor of the church, and the Rev. Earl J. Rogers, minister of the Full Gospel Church, will conduct services. Burial will be in Pecan Grove Cemetery, directed by Harris-Horn Funeral Home.
Mr. Davis was born in Collin County, the son of County Judge and Mrs H. L. Davis. He had been McKinney postmaster and a county commissioner. On April 27, 1915, he married Gladys Weaver. He was a member of the First Christian Church, which he served as a deacon. He was a Mason and a graduate of Texas __ College.
